Our team is committed to enhancing physician and patient quality of life through Elation, a SaaS cloud-based clinical platform. Since inception, we’ve been focused on building a world-class technology solution that creates an experience of delight and ease for physicians, and that our users love. 

At Elation, we are reimagining how we work with AI as a foundational capability, accelerating the impact of every individual. We want our internal systems of work to feel connected end-to-end, not fragmented by handoffs and bottlenecks. Today, much of our work passes across multiple teams, creating delays and friction. We are looking for an AI Operations Manager who can help us see those systems clearly, break them down, and reimagine them with an AI-native lens.

This is a hands-on role, where success is measured by the impact you create, simplifying processes, unblocking bottlenecks, and unlocking efficiency that helps Elation achieve its critical objectives. You’ll analyze how work currently flows, identify where the system stalls, and build and test lightweight prototypes to prove better ways forward. You don’t need to be a deep technical expert, but you should be curious about AI, comfortable experimenting, and eager to build first-pass solutions that others can refine and scale.


What You’ll Do

Discovery & Analysis

  • Unlock efficiency at scale by mapping current systems of work across teams (e.g., onboarding, operations, customer success, support) and deploying focused interventions that drive outsized results.
  • Identify bottlenecks and breakpoints that limit end-to-end flow due to duplicated effort, manual steps, or inconsistent practices across teams.

Design & Build

  • Reimagine flows from an AI-native perspective, proposing orchestrations where automation, AI assistance, or smarter design can reduce friction and accelerate results.
  • Act as a connector between business users, data/tech teams, and leadership, ensuring system improvements make an impact on company goals.
  • Prototype solutions: create early versions of automations, scripts, mockups, or process orchestrations that test your ideas in practice.
  • Design and deploy operational systems: take a builder’s approach to shaping how Elation works by (1) building internal systems where needed, (2) assessing build-vs-buy options for tools and platforms, and (3) leading deployment and adoption of chosen solutions.

Scale & Impact

  • Partner with product, engineering, and operations to translate validated prototypes into durable solutions and advocate for high ROI product development investments.
  • Measure impact by tracking improvements such as faster cycle times, fewer handoffs, reduced manual work, and higher team satisfaction.
  • Document new operating models and ensure that updated approaches are clear, standardized, and adoptable across teams.

What You Bring

Systems & Strategy

  • Analytical mindset: ability to break down complex systems, map flows, and think in end-to-end outcomes.
  • Change leadership and collaboration: experienced in working across functions, listening to pain points, and co-creating solutions with the ability to guide teams through rapid change and help them adapt to new systems and tools.
  • AI native approach: experience applying AI in your own work to reshape flows, reduce bottlenecks, and unlock new possibilities for others.

Execution & Enablement

  • Builder mentality: comfortable rolling up your sleeves to prototype, whether through scripts, low-code tools, or wireframes and able to judge when to build internally versus adopting external tools, weighing trade-offs in speed, cost, and scalability.
  • Clear communicator: able to document orchestrations, write SOPs, and explain system changes to both technical and non-technical audiences.
  • Data literacy: able to use dashboards, metrics, or basic analysis to support your recommendations.

Nice to Have
  • Experience with Lean, Six Sigma, or other process improvement approaches.
  • Familiarity with AI-enabled tools or workflow automation platforms.
  • Familiarity with AI-assisted coding tools.
  • Prior experience in SaaS or fast-growing environments.
  • Comfort with light scripting or prototyping in low-code/no-code environments

What you need to know about the Charlotte Tech Scene

Ranked among the hottest tech cities in 2024 by CompTIA, Charlotte is quickly cementing its place as a major U.S. tech hub. Home to more than 90,000 tech workers, the city’s ecosystem is primed for continued growth, fueled by billions in annual funding from heavyweights like Microsoft and RevTech Labs, which has created thousands of fintech jobs and made the city a go-to for tech pros looking for their next big opportunity.

Key Facts About Charlotte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 90,859; 6.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lowe’s, Bank of America, TIAA, Microsoft, Honeywell
  • Key Industries: Fintech, art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, cloud computing, e-commerce
  •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(CED)
  • Notable Investors: Microsoft, Google, Falfurrias Management Partners, RevTech Labs Foundation
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of North Carolina at Charlotte, Northeastern University, North Carolina Research Campus
